The customer pays Glide one payment that covers all the utilities they have requested Glide to cover - Glide themselves do not supply any of the utility services. For anyone that doesn't already know of Glide - they are a company that brings all utilities under one bill, aimed mostly at students and businesses, enabling easier budgeting. The Glide is a patented pontoon boat hydrofoil that lifts your pontoon so it will get on plane faster.
